ShawnDen-coder / amazing-digital-cinema

A curated list of resources for film technicians

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Amazing Digital Cinema

A curated list of resources for film technicians in the fields of digital cinema content mastering, delivery, archiving and exhibition.

Please contribute to this list!

If you don't know how to contribute on GitHub, please follow this guide and the guidelines of this repository. If this is too much of an effort for you to learn, but you still want to contribute, then post an issue here on Github with your suggestion(s) for adding to the list.

This list was inspired by the awesome-broadcasting list. Which itself was inspired by the awesome awesome list. In contrast, this list also lists non open-source resources. To reflect this matter and out of respect towards the open-source only awesome list projects, I named this list amazing digital cinema instead of awesome digital cinema.

Interest Groups

Resources

Books

Discussion Papers & Articles

Education

Forums

  • dcinemaforum – general digital cinema forum, with slight focus on the DCP mastering software OpenDCP.
  • DCP-o-matic User Forum – user forum of the DCP mastering software DCP-o-matic.
  • ISDCF Online Forum – online forum of the professional association Inter-Society Digital Cinema Forum (ISDCF).
  • Lift Gamma Gain – colorist forum, also with focus on digital cinema workflows and DCP mastering.

Knowledge Sources

  • Cinepedia – knowledge base about DCP mastering, delivery and exhibition.
  • Knut Erik Evensen – insights into DCP mastering, delivery and exhibition.

Lists

News

  • Celluloid Junkie – news resource, dedicated to the global film and cinema business.
  • CineTechGeek – james Gardiner's video blog about digital cinema technology.
  • DCinema Today – industry sponsored press release site about digital cinema technology.
  • Digital Cinema Report – news, perspective and analysis on the digital cinema industry.
  • mkpeReport – news, perspective and analysis on digital cinema technology.

Standards & Recommendations

Tools

Command Line Tools

  • ClairMeta – command line tool for checking and probing of Digital Cinema Packages.
  • dcp_inspect – tool for inspection and validation of DCPs (SMPTE and Interop).
  • IFIscripts – scripts developed and used by the IFI Irish Film Archive.

DCP Duplication

  • DCP360 : D2 DCP duplicator – a compact 19 inch stackable device that is equipped with CRU slots.
  • dcp.py – open-source command line tool for formatting a hard drive for cinema usage.
  • DCP Transfer – format hard drives and copy DCPs for delivery (macOS version).
  • LIHUE – DCP volume management appliance. Format, copy, validate.

File Transfer

  • Aspera – a multitude of solutions for large, fast file transfer.
  • Bagger – Application to produce a package of data files according to the BagIt specification.
  • bagit-python – a Python library and command line utility for working with BagIt style packages.
  • MASV – fast, large file transfer in the browser, no client software needed. Pay as you go.
  • Media Shuttle – browser and desktop solutions for large, fast file transfer.
  • MediaSilo – video asset management & sharing solution.
  • Signiant – move large files with speed, reliability, and security.
  • Qube Wire – deliver DCPs and KDMs to cinemas worldwide.

Framerate Converters

  • Alchemist File – framerate converter.
  • PixelStrings – framerate conversions, standards conversion and transcoding in the cloud. Pay as you go.
  • Tachyon – framerate conversions, standards conversions, reverse telecine and frame rate normalization.

KDM Tools

  • DCPtools KDM Studio – online KDM creation, with cinema database. Pay as you go (bundle prices).
  • easyDCP KDM Generator+ – allows to use external DKDM (Distribution KDM) generate KDMs.
  • KEYMASTER – online KDM creation, with cinema database. Annual subscription.
  • Qube Wire – deliver DCPs and KDMs to cinemas worldwide.

Leq(m) Meters

Mastering Tools

  • CLIPSTER – DCP/IMP mastering, player and KDM creation system for the professional market.
  • CORTEX Cloud – transcode and master DCPs, IMPs (IMF) and additional formats.
  • CORTEX Enterprise – transcode and master DCPs, IMPs (IMF) and additional formats.
  • DaVinci Resolve Studio – all in one solution with DCP, IMP (IMF) mastering capabilities.
  • DCP-o-matic – open-source DCP mastering, player and KDM creation software.
  • easyDCP – DCP/IMP mastering, player and KDM creation software for the professional market.
  • MIST – DCP/IMP mastering, player and KDM creation system/software for the professional market.
  • OpenDCP – open-source DCP mastering software.
  • WAILUA – DCP/IMP mastering software for the professional market.

Plug-ins

QC Player

Software Libraries

  • asdcplib – open-source implementation of the SMPTE and Interop MXF “Sound & Picture Track File” format.
  • ClairMeta – library for checking and probing of Digital Cinema Packages.
  • Colour – a color science package for Python.
  • Comprimato – commerical GPU JPEG 2000 codec.
  • grok – open-source JPEG 2000 codec - fork of OpenJPEG.
  • itu-r-468-weighting – a zero dependency Python ITU-R 468 noise weighting filter (1 kHz and 2 kHz).
  • Kakadu – commercial JPEG 2000 codec.
  • leqm-nrt – a non-real-time implementation of Leq(M) measurement according to ISO 21727.
  • libdcp – open-source library for reading and writing Digital Cinema Packages (DCPs).
  • libsub – open-source subtitle reading/writing library.
  • MovieLabs Digital Distribution Framework (MDDF) – framework for the various MDDF standards.
  • node-cpl – a Node.js library for CPL-parsing.
  • OpenJPEG – open-source JPEG 2000 codec written in C.
  • OpenTimelineIO – interchange format and API for editorial cut information.
  • Photon – Photon is an open-source Java implementation of the Interoperable Master Format (IMF) standard.
  • python-dcitools – a Python library for working with digital cinema server APIs.
  • regxmllib – Java library for the creation of XML representations of MXF header metadata.
  • smpte-timecode – a JavaScript library for operations with SMPTE timecodes.
  • timecode – a Python module that handles SMPTE timecode.

Standalone

  • DCP-Subtitle Extract – extract DCP subtitles and save them as SRT (SubRib) file.
  • IMFTool – a tool for editing IMF CPLs and creating new versions of an existing IMF package.
  • Annotation Edit – subtitle program (macOS only) that supports digital cinema Interop and SMPTE subtitles.
  • Subtitle Edit – open-source subtitle program that supports digital cinema subtitles.
  • Bulk Rename Utility – freeware (Windows only) program for renaming vast amounts of files.

Transcoding Engines

  • CORTEX Cloud – transcode and master DCPs, IMPs (IMF) and additional formats (not the same as IE's Cortex).
  • CORTEX Enterprise – transcode and master DCPs, IMPs (IMF) and additional formats (not the same as IE's Cortex).
  • PixelStrings – framerate conversions, standards conversion and transcoding in the cloud. Pay as you go.
  • TORNADO – transcoding engine for DCPs, IMPs (IMF) and additional formats.
  • Transkoder – transcoding engine for DCPs, IMPs (IMF) and additional formats.

Web Apps

  • CineLexi Web Tools – web tools for DCP CPL insides, timecode calculation and timecode bulk conversion.
  • Color Space Calculator – online color space calculator for RGB color spaces.
  • CPL Translator – a web tool that parses DCPs and IMPs (IMF).
  • DCP QA Tools – free (sign up only) DCP quality assurance and audio level assurance tools.
  • DIVO – a Dolby Vision HDR web tool. Parse, compare and edit Dolby Vision XML.
  • Dolby Log Analyzer – a web app that scans Dolby D-cinema server logs to produce an overview.
  • Michael Cinquin tools – web tools, e.g. timecode calculator, DCP-subtitle creator and DCP versioning.
  • Online Reg-XML MXF Dump Tool – only a few bytes are uploaded to the server.

Workflow tools

  • CineFMS – an open-source framework for film festival DCP workflow management, used at the Berlinale.
  • Cortex – open-source framework for computation, rendering, and file I/O (not the same as MTI's CORTEX).
  • Frame.io – cloud-based collaboration platform.
  • Gaffer – open-source framework to automate processes, build production workflows and more (based on Cortex).
  • Kitsu – open-source production tracker for indie studios.
  • Kitsu, hosted at CGWire - hosted production tracker for indie studios.
  • MCMA Project Repos - open-source serverless architecture and media workflows in the cloud.
  • Mistika Workflows – standard & user-defined media workflows.
  • TACTIC – open-source platform for enterprise workflow solutions (originated in the VFX industry).

About

A curated list of resources for film technicians

License:Other